TWO Pakenham teams, Blue and Red, fought out the section 1 grand final in the night competition of the West Gippsland Tennis Association.
Red got off to a flier, winning the first set 6-1 and was leading the second set 5-3 before Blue staged a great comeback to win the set 7-5.
The third and fourth sets were very close, with Blue holding a steady nerve in both sets, to win 6-4 and 7-6. This meant Blue went into the final two sets leading in sets 3-1 with the games level.
Red had to win both the remaining sets. They won one 6-4, however, Blue won the other set, 6-2. The final score was Pakenham Blue 4 sets, 31 games to Pakenham Red 2 sets 29 games.
The section 2 grand final was between Tooradin and Catani.
The first two sets were extremely close, with Catani winning the first 7-5 and Tooradin the other in a tie-breaker.
The third set saw Tooradin win another tie-breaker. Tooradin also won the fourth 6-4. Similar to the section 1 grand final, this meant Catani had to win both of the final sets to win. Catani won one 6-4, but Tooradin took the other one 6-3. The final score was Tooradin 4 sets 35 games to Catani’s 2 sets 32 games.
